Hamamelis virginiana 'Little Suzie' - Little Suzie common witch-hazel
.
Common name: Little Suzie common witch-hazel
Family: Hamamelidaceae (witch-hazel family)
Distribution: Species native to e.-c. and e. North America
Hardiness: USDA Zone 5
Life form: Deciduous shrub/Subshrub
Comments: A dwarf form originating as a seedling at Hidden Hollow Nursery, Belvedere, TN, and named by the owner, Harold Neubauer on behalf of his late wife, Suzie, Little Suzie common witch-hazel presents the gardener with all the fine qualities of the species but maturing only 4' tall and wide. This densely branched shrub flowers profusely in October/November displaying pale yellow flowers.
